Pathfinder - Gold Camp Emblem

This year, we have six Pathfinders in our unit who are working on their Gold Camp Emblem. This is the final challenge the 3rd Year Pathfinders must complete in order to earn Canada Cord. Canada Cord is the highest award a Pathfinder can receive. In a special ceremony in September, all the Pathfinders in this Province who earn Canada Cord will be presented with this award by the Lieutenant Governor of Nova Scotia.

For Gold Camp, the 3rd Year Pathfinders are in charge of their own tent teams. They plan "everything" for the "entire" weekend. The unit Guiders and Junior Leader attend camp and evaluate the Gold Camps. This is the first time we have used the Internet to organize our unit's Gold Camp work.

Gold Camp was held in May, and the Pathfinders completed their paperwork. Please see examples of their submissions below, as well as their thoughts of Gold Camp.
